Airs 7:00-8:00 PM, ET/ PT, After NFL Football, on the CBS Television Network and Paramount + VACCINE COURT – With vaccinations increasingly a point of political tension, correspondent Jon Wertheim reports on the National Vaccine Injury Compensation Program – a “no fault” vaccine court that balances the public health benefits of widespread vaccination with rare cases of harm to individuals. Founded in the 1980s, the program has paid out billions of dollars to thousands of Americans. Denise Schrier Cetta is the producer. KDKA/CBS PITTSBURGH PROMOTES AWARD-WINNING JOURNALIST AND NEWSROOM LEADER CATHY NOSCHESE TO VICE PRESIDENT AND NEWS DIRECTOR
Cathy Noschese/CBS Pittsburgh PITTSBURGH – Oct. 3, 2025 – CBS Pittsburgh announces Cathy Noschese as the station’s vice president and news director, effective Oct. 5. In her new role, Noschese will oversee the newsroom’s day-to-day operations, strategy and editorial direction. “I am honored for this opportunity to lead this talented newsroom that has been such a meaningful part of my life and career,” said Noschese. “I’m proud of the work we’ve already done and energized by the opportunity to build on that legacy to serve our viewers with the trusted local journalism they count on.” ...
